The Importance of Core Strength and Alignment in Barre Workouts

Barre workouts have gained immense popularity in recent years for their ability to sculpt long, lean muscles and improve flexibility. One of the key elements that sets barre apart from other forms of exercise is its focus on core strength and alignment.
Why is Core Strength Important?
Your core muscles are not just your abs; they include all the muscles in your midsection, from your pelvis to your shoulders. A strong core is essential for maintaining proper posture, supporting your spine, and improving balance and stability.
Benefits of Core Strength in Barre
- Enhanced stability during exercises
- Increased muscle engagement and toning
- Improved posture and body alignment
- Reduced risk of injury
Alignment in Barre
Proper alignment in barre exercises is crucial for maximizing the effectiveness of each movement and preventing strain on joints and muscles. Instructors often emphasize alignment cues to help participants engage the right muscles and avoid injury.
How to Improve Core Strength and Alignment
Here are some tips to enhance your core strength and alignment in barre workouts:
- Focus on engaging your core muscles throughout the entire workout.
- Listen to alignment cues from your instructor and make adjustments as needed.
- Practice proper breathing techniques to support your core activation.
- Work on your balance and stability by incorporating challenging exercises into your routine.
